Tribune News Service

Mohali, August 14

The Mohali police have brought notorious criminal Dharminder Singh Gugni on production warrant in case of firing at Punjabi singer Parmish Verma, here.

According to the police, Gugni’s name has cropped up in the case during the interrogation of Dilpreet Singh Dhahan, who, along with his four accomplices, had opened fire on Verma on the intervening night of April 13 and 14.

Though the police remained tight-lipped on revealing the reason behind bringing Gugni on production warrant from the Nabha Jail, sources claimed that he might have supplied firearms to Dilpreet Singh and Rinda’s gang.

It is to be noted that Gugni is also accused in the case of recent target killings of Hindu leaders in Punjab. The case is being investigated by the NIA. According to NIA sources, Gugni had supplied firearms to certain killers in the case of target killings.

Besides, Gugni has also been awarded life sentence by a Mohali court in the murder case of local advocate Amarpreet Singh, aka Lucky.

The Mohali police said Gugni was produced before a local court, which sent him to 3-day police remand.
